What is an Email Newsletter?
An email newsletter is a digital publication sent out directly to customers’ inboxes, created to keep them notified about a specific subject, industry, or brand name. These newsletters typically include important material, marketing suggestions, insights, and updates, permitting both companies and individuals to express their creativity.

The primary objective is to engage the audience, promote a sense of community, and deal actionable suggestions that resonates with readers. In doing so, the newsletters enhance brand name authority and aid attain marketing goals.

An Email Marketing Service
Selecting the ideal email marketing service is necessary for ensuring that your marketing newsletter effectively reaches your audience while sticking to best practices for email deliverability.

When evaluating your options, it is very important to consider a number of crucial functions that can substantially impact your campaigns.

User-friendliness: Seek out a platform that is intuitive and easy to navigate. This will allow you to create engaging newsletters without dealing with a high learning curve.
Tracking Metrics: Search for functions that allow in-depth analysis of open rates, click-through rates, and customer engagement. These metrics are vital for evaluating the success of your campaigns.
Compliance with Standards: Ensure that the service complies with email deliverability standards to reduce the threat of your messages landing in spam folders.
By keeping these factors in mind, you can pick an e-mail marketing service that not only satisfies your requirements however also improves your general marketing technique.

A List of Subscribers
Constructing a robust subscriber list is important for promoting audience engagement and establishing a successful development strategy for your newsletter.

To attain this goal, it is beneficial to check out different approaches that not just attract prospective customers but also preserve their interest over time. One efficient method involves using exclusive promos or rewards, such as discount rates, complimentary resources, or early access to content. By clearly positioning these offerings, individuals are more likely to subscribe when they acknowledge the instant worth.

Consider carrying out the following methods:

Network with your audience across social media channels to generate buzz and excitement about your newsletter.
Utilise engaging pop-ups on your site to remind visitors of the valuable material they might be missing out on.
Make sure that the subscription procedure is simple and easy to use; a positive user experience can considerably boost retention rates.
Furthermore, it is beneficial to send follow-up e-mails or thank-you notes after somebody subscribes. This practice helps to develop a connection and encourages ongoing engagement with your content.

Identify Your Target Market
Determining the target market is a vital initial step in crafting a content method that truly resonates with their requirements and choices. Think about exploring internet marketing techniques that finest suit your audience.

To determine these individuals, numerous approaches can be utilized, such as conducting studies or examining existing information to get insights into market aspects like age, place, and interests. This understanding can be enriched by developing comprehensive purchaser personalities, which represent typical customers who engage with your brand. Comprehending these personalities is indispensable, as it informs the tone, format, and details you provide in your content.

Here are some methods to section your audience successfully:

Utilise analytics tools to track user behaviour on your platforms.
Engage in social listening to comprehend the discussions your target audience is having online.
Segment your audience based upon their stage in the purchaser’s journey, tailoring material to resolve their specific requirements.
When these strategies are carried out effectively, they boost content positioning, guaranteeing that every piece of product speaks directly to the audience’s issues and interests.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I begin an email newsletter?
To start an e-mail newsletter, first choose the purpose of your newsletter and what type of material you wish to consist of. Next, select an email marketing service or software to handle and send your newsletters. Then, develop a mailing list and design a template for your newsletter. Lastly, start creating and sending your newsletters on a regular schedule.

What is the function of an e-mail newsletter?
The function of an email newsletter is to communicate with a targeted audience and supply them with valuable and relevant details. It can be utilized to promote services or products, share company news, such as from HubSpot or B2B SaaS business, and engage with clients or subscribers.

How frequently should I send my e-mail newsletter?
The frequency of your email newsletter will depend on your audience and the kind of content you are sending out. It is recommended to send newsletters on a constant schedule, whether it’s weekly, bi-weekly, or monthly, to keep your subscribers engaged and interested.

What type of material should I consist of in my email newsletter?
The content of your email newsletter need to be determined by your audience and the purpose of the newsletter. It can include company updates, advertising offers, practical pointers or recommendations, valuable resources, and any other appropriate information that would benefit your customers.

How can I grow my email newsletter subscriber list?
To grow your e-mail newsletter subscriber list, you can promote your newsletter on your site or social media platforms, offer incentives for people to subscribe, such as through beehiiv, and ask present subscribers to show their buddies and networks. You can likewise work together with other organizations or influencers, like Ashley Reese or Dana Nicole, to reach a larger audience.

Can I personalise my e-mail newsletter?
Yes, you can customise your email newsletter by dealing with customers by their name, segmenting your newsletter and sending out targeted content based on their interests or behaviour, and utilizing a conversational tone in your writing.
